Artificial General Intelligence

Artificial general intelligence (AGI) is the intelligence of a machine that could successfully perform any intellectual task that a human being can. General intelligence is a function of many combined, interconnected features produced by brain. Here, you will learn how quantum computing, deep learning, reinforcement learning, computational neuroscience, robotics, cognitive modeling can be used to develop for  building “thinking machines”; that is, general-purpose systems with intelligence comparable to that of the human mind.  Additional topics will include AI safety and ethics.

Presently, Artificial Narrow Intelligence (ANI) based  systems are only capable of specific tasks. They can perform activities such as internet searches, driving a car, or playing a video game. However, but none of the systems today can do all of these tasks, where as a single Artificial general intelligence, AGI would be able to accomplish a variety of cognitive tasks similar to that of human. Quantum Computing and Artificial Intelligence

Artificial intelligence (AI) is an area of science that emphasizes the development of intelligent systems that can work and behave like humans. Quantum computing is essentially using the amazing laws of quantum mechanics to enhance computing power. These two emergent technologies will likely have huge transforming impact on our society in the future. Quantum computing is finding a vital platform in providing speed-ups for machine learning problems, critical to big data analysis, blockchain and IoT.
